[发明专利]开机标志定制方法、系统、终端及存储介质在审
申请号: | 202110322726.7 | 申请日: | 2021-03-26 |
公开(公告)号: | CN113076157A | 公开(公告)日: | 2021-07-06 |
发明(设计)人: | 王优博;李道童;芦飞 | 申请(专利权)人: | 山东英信计算机技术有限公司 |
主分类号: | G06F9/451 | 分类号: | G06F9/451;G06F8/41;G06F21/60 |
代理公司: | 济南舜源专利事务所有限公司 37205 | 代理人: | 孙玉营 |
地址: | 250101 山东省济南市高新区*** | 国省代码: | 山东;37 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 开机 标志 定制 方法 系统 终端 存储 介质 | ||
本发明提供一种开机标志定制方法、系统、终端及存储介质,包括:指定目标二进制文件和目标图片的存储路径;利用自动化脚本调用文件拆分工具将目标二进制文件拆分为第一子文件和第二子文件,所述第一子文件中保存有原标志图片;调用图片替换工具将第一子文件中的原标志图片替换为目标图片,得到新第一子文件;利用文件编译工具将所述新第一子文件与所述第二子文件编译为新二进制文件,所述新二进制文件为定制开机标志使用的二进制文件。本发明极大地节约了人力,提高了效率,减少新版本的出现加重维护任务。
技术领域
本发明涉及服务器技术领域,具体涉及一种开机标志定制方法、系统、终端及存储介质。
背景技术
近年来,随着大数据及云计算等业务的发展,服务器逐渐普及到各行各业,客户需求逐年增加。对不同机型服务器和客户根据其应用场景的不同,选择使用不同的logo,其核心固件BIOS需根据客户需求更改logo以适配不同的客户需求,以往通过代码来修改logo的方法极其浪费时间,且无法保证质量,本发明提出的使用自动化脚本修改logo的方法可有效地提高开发的效率,并有效避免代码修改logo的繁琐和低效。
发明内容
针对现有技术的上述不足,本发明提供一种开机标志定制方法、系统、终端及存储介质,以解决上述技术问题。
第一方面,本发明提供一种开机标志定制方法,包括:
指定目标二进制文件和目标图片的存储路径;
利用自动化脚本调用文件拆分工具将目标二进制文件拆分为第一子文件和第二子文件,所述第一子文件中保存有原标志图片;
调用图片替换工具将第一子文件中的原标志图片替换为目标图片,得到新第一子文件;
利用文件编译工具将所述新第一子文件与所述第二子文件编译为新二进制文件,所述新二进制文件为定制开机标志使用的二进制文件。
进一步的,所述方法还包括:
将自动化脚本工具包、目标二进制文件和目标图片保存至同一路径下。
进一步的,所述方法还包括:
在将所述新第一子文件与所述第二子文件编译为新二进制文件之前,向所述新第一子文件添加校验码。
进一步的,所述方法还包括:
利用客制密钥对新二进制文件进行加密。
第二方面,本发明提供一种开机标志定制系统,包括:
目标指定单元,配置用于指定目标二进制文件和目标图片的存储路径;
文件拆分单元,配置用于利用自动化脚本调用文件拆分工具将目标二进制文件拆分为第一子文件和第二子文件,所述第一子文件中保存有原标志图片;
图片替换单元,配置用于调用图片替换工具将第一子文件中的原标志图片替换为目标图片,得到新第一子文件;
文件编译单元,配置用于利用文件编译工具将所述新第一子文件与所述第二子文件编译为新二进制文件,所述新二进制文件为定制开机标志使用的二进制文件。
进一步的,所述系统还包括:
文件存储单元,配置用于将自动化脚本工具包、目标二进制文件和目标图片保存至同一路径下。
进一步的,所述系统还包括:
校验添加单元,配置用于在将所述新第一子文件与所述第二子文件编译为新二进制文件之前,向所述新第一子文件添加校验码。
进一步的,所述系统还包括:
文件加密单元,配置用于利用客制密钥对新二进制文件进行加密。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于山东英信计算机技术有限公司,未经山东英信计算机技术有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/202110322726.7/2.html,转载请声明来源钻瓜专利网。